Transaction 5b625940de78680a0d8ccec90607fdf2f99de0150743e4394f7a9cef864044a5
1 Input
1 Output
-
5b625940de78680a0d8ccec90607fdf2f99de0150743e4394f7a9cef864044a5:0
- value
- 5365801
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2cbc41fbe66ee59e30db78ad7cfc22e0f446a23 OP_EQUAL
- address
- 3NNCjpDcumNH3dYxLPbw5uJsEfhsZwEFhW